What problem does it solve?

Enforces consistent Git workflows by applying guardrails for commits, hooks, branches, and PR templates to prevent messy histories and inconsistent reviews.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Enforces Conventional Commits and commitlint hooks to ensure consistent commit messages.
  • Configures branch naming rules and PR templates to standardize reviews and collaboration.
  • Provides templates and guidance for documentation and bypass procedures to handle emergencies.
